轻量级应用服务器可以自己安装mysql吗?

云计算

是的,轻量级应用服务器可以自己安装 MySQL

“轻量级应用服务器”通常指的是资源占用较少、配置简单的云服务器实例(例如腾讯云轻量应用服务器、阿里云轻量应用服务器等)。这类服务器本质上是基于 Linux 或 Windows 的虚拟机,用户拥有管理员权限(如 root 或 sudo 权限),因此完全可以自行安装和配置 MySQL 数据库。


✅ 你可以这样做:

1. 登录服务器

通过 SSH(Linux)或远程桌面(Windows)登录到你的轻量服务器。

2. 安装 MySQL

以常见的 Ubuntu/Debian 系统为例:

# 更新软件包列表
sudo apt update

# 安装 MySQL 服务器
sudo apt install mysql-server -y

# 启动 MySQL 服务并设置开机自启
sudo systemctl start mysql
sudo systemctl enable mysql

# 运行安全配置向导(推荐)
sudo mysql_secure_installation

对于 CentOS/RHEL 系列:

# 安装 MySQL(以 MySQL 8.0 为例)
sudo dnf install @mysql:8.0 -y

# 启动并启用服务
sudo systemctl start mysqld
sudo systemctl enable mysqld

# 查看临时密码(首次启动时生成)
sudo grep 'temporary password' /var/log/mysqld.log

# 运行安全配置
sudo mysql_secure_installation

⚠️ 注意事项:

  1. 资源限制:轻量服务器通常内存较小(如 1GB~2GB),运行 MySQL 时需注意优化配置,避免内存溢出。

    • 可修改 my.cnf 配置文件,降低 innodb_buffer_pool_size 等参数。
  2. 端口开放

    • 默认 MySQL 使用 3306 端口,如果需要远程连接,需在服务器控制台配置防火墙或安全组规则,放行该端口。
    • 建议仅对可信 IP 开放,避免暴露在公网带来安全风险。
  3. 数据安全

    • 定期备份数据库。
    • 设置强密码,避免使用默认账户远程登录。
  4. 性能考虑

    • 如果应用访问量较大,建议将数据库与应用分离,或升级更高配置的服务器。

✅ 替代方案(可选)

  • 使用云服务商提供的 托管数据库服务(如腾讯云 CDB、阿里云 RDS),更稳定、易维护,但成本较高。
  • 若只是简单用途(如小网站、测试环境),本地安装 MySQL 是经济高效的选择。

总结:

✅ 轻量级应用服务器完全可以自己安装 MySQL,操作自由、成本低,适合个人项目、学习或小型应用。只要注意资源管理和安全性即可。

如有具体系统(如 Ubuntu 20.04)或问题(如无法远程连接),欢迎继续提问!